
OpenZFS 2.3.4 બે મહિના પછી આવ્યો છે 2.3.3 જાળવણી અપડેટ તરીકે, જે તેના રૂઢિચુસ્ત સ્વભાવ હોવા છતાં, માંગણી કરનારા સંચાલકો માટે ઉપયોગી ફેરફારો લાવે છે: તાજેતરના કર્નલ સાથે વધુ સુસંગતતા, ડેટા ફરીથી લખવા માટે એક નવો સબકમાન્ડ, અને ઘણા સુધારાઓ. વધુમાં, સમાંતર રીતે, નીચેની જાહેરાત કરવામાં આવી છે: ઓપનઝેડએફએસ 2.4.0 આરસી1 પ્રોજેક્ટ ક્યાં જઈ રહ્યો છે તેની પૂર્વાવલોકન તરીકે કામ કરતા સારા સુધારાઓ સાથે.
આ લેખમાં આપણે વ્યવહારુ રીતે એકત્રિત અને સમજાવીએ છીએ ઉલ્લેખિત બધા સમાચાર ઉપલબ્ધ સ્ત્રોતોમાં: સંસ્કરણ 2.3.4 માં શું ફેરફાર થાય છે, તેના સપોર્ટેડ પ્લેટફોર્મ કયા છે, નવું શું છે zfs પુનર્લેખન, અને તે બધું 2.3 શ્રેણીમાં કેવી રીતે બંધબેસે છે (2.3.0 શું રજૂ કરે છે તે સહિત).
OpenZFS 2.3.4 શું લાવે છે
નવી સ્ટેબલ પોઈન્ટ રિલીઝ વિસ્તૃત કરે છે 6.16 સુધી લિનક્સ કર્નલ સુસંગતતા, જ્યારે 2.3.3 6.15 પર બંધ થયું. તે Linux 4.18 ને બેકવર્ડ સપોર્ટ જાળવી રાખે છે અને આવરી લે છે ૧૩.૩ થી ફ્રીબીએસડી, આગામી 15.0 સહિત. આ વિસ્તૃત સુસંગતતા એ લોકો માટે માનસિક શાંતિ પ્રદાન કરે છે જેઓ અદ્યતન ZFS સુવિધાઓનો ભોગ આપ્યા વિના તેમની બેઝ સિસ્ટમને અપગ્રેડ કરે છે.
2.3.4 નો તારો એ નો ઉમેરો છે zfs ફરીથી લખાણ સબકમાન્ડ. તેની સાથે, તેઓ આવે છે ફ્રીબીએસડી માટે સુધારાઓ, પેકેજિંગ સુધારાઓ અને નાના સુધારાઓ જે એકંદર કામગીરીને વધુ સારી બનાવે છે. તે એક એવું સંસ્કરણ છે જે મજબૂતાઈ અને જાળવણી માટે રચાયેલ છે, નહીં કે વિક્ષેપકારક ફેરફારો સાથે ટેબલ તોડવા માટે.
zfs ફરીથી લખો: ડેટાને સ્પર્શ કર્યા વિના તેને ફરીથી સ્થાનાંતરિત કરો (અને વધુ ઝડપી)
વર્ષોથી ઘણા વપરાશકર્તાઓ વીજળી માંગી રહ્યા છે vdevs ઉમેર્યા પછી પૂલને ફરીથી સંતુલિત કરો, રેન્ડમલી લખેલી ફાઇલોને ડિફ્રેગમેન્ટ કરો, અથવા હાલના ડેટામાં નવા ગુણધર્મો લાગુ કરો. અત્યાર સુધી, વિકલ્પો હતા નકલ કરો/નામ બદલો અથવા ડેટાસેટ્સ મોકલી/પ્રાપ્ત કરીને અને નામ બદલીને, સ્પષ્ટ ખામીઓ (I/O ખર્ચ, વિન્ડો સમય, કેશ અને મેટાડેટા પર અસર) સાથે ઉકેલો.
નવો સબકમાન્ડ પરવાનગી આપે છે ફાઇલોની સામગ્રી "જેમ છે તેમ" ફરીથી લખો. પરંતુ તેમને બીજા વિસ્તારમાં અને વિવિધ ગુણધર્મો સાથે મૂકીને: તમે બદલી શકો છો સાઇટ, આ કમ્પ્રેશન અલ્ગોરિધમનો, આ ચેકસમ, જો લાગુ પડે તો ડુપ્લિકેશનની સંખ્યા શું તમે કોપી કરો છો અને અન્ય પરિમાણો, ડેટાને તાર્કિક રીતે અકબંધ રાખીને.
કૃપા એ છે કે તે વાંચન અને પુનર્લેખન કરતાં ઝડપી, કારણ કે તે ડેટાને યુઝર સ્પેસમાં કોપી થવાથી અટકાવે છે. ડેટાસેટ્સમાં sync=always તે ઝડપી પણ છે કારણ કે, ડેટામાં કોઈ ફેરફાર થતો નથી, ZIL ને લખવા માટે દબાણ કરતું નથી. પ્રક્રિયા આનાથી સુરક્ષિત છે રેન્જ લોક્સ સામાન્ય, જેથી તે ચલાવી શકાય કોઈપણ ભાર હેઠળ, જરૂર કરતાં વધુ સિસ્ટમને અવરોધિત કર્યા વિના. અને, ખૂબ જ મહત્વપૂર્ણ, mtime ને સ્પર્શતું નથી અથવા અન્ય ફાઇલ ગુણધર્મો.
એક લાક્ષણિક પ્રવાહ દોડવા જેટલો સરળ હોઈ શકે છે zfs પુનર્લેખન એક અથવા વધુ લક્ષ્ય ફાઇલો પર નવી આંતરિક ગુણધર્મો સાથે તેમને સ્થાનાંતરિત કરવા માટે. આ 2.3.4 પ્રકાશન મૂળભૂત સુવિધા રજૂ કરે છે; આપણે પછીથી વધારાના વિકલ્પો જોઈશું, જે 2.4 RC1 ના ભાગ રૂપે પ્રકાશિત થઈ રહ્યા છે.
સુસંગતતા અને પ્લેટફોર્મ
OpenZFS 2.3.4 સત્તાવાર રીતે માન્ય થયું લિનક્સ ૪.૧૮ થી ૬.૧૬ y ફ્રીબીએસડી ૧૩.૩ થી આગળ, આગામી 15.0 સહિત. આ વ્યાપક શ્રેણી લાંબા ગાળાના સર્વર ડિપ્લોયમેન્ટ અને નવીનતમ કર્નલ પર ચાલતા વાતાવરણ બંનેને સુવિધા આપે છે.
પાછલા ચક્રમાં, ટીમે 2.3 શ્રેણીનું RC રજૂ કર્યું હતું જેમાં સપોર્ટ હતો લિનક્સ 6.12 એલટીએસ, વિતરણોમાં તેના ઉપયોગ માટે એક મહત્વપૂર્ણ સંસ્કરણ જેમ કે CentOS સ્ટ્રીમ 10 અને અન્ય. તે કાર્યને એકીકૃત કરવામાં આવ્યું છે, અને 2.3.4 સ્થિરતા જાળવી રાખીને આધુનિક કર્નલ માટે સતત વિસ્તૃત સમર્થનને પ્રતિબિંબિત કરે છે.
સુધારા અને જાળવણી
નવા સબકમાન્ડ ઉપરાંત, આ સંસ્કરણ પહોંચાડે છે ફ્રીબીએસડી માં સેટિંગ્સ, ના ફેરફારો પેકેજિંગ અને ઘણા ભૂલ સુધારાઓ ઓછા મહત્વના. તે કોઈ માઈલ લાંબો ચેન્જલોગ નથી, પરંતુ ઉત્પાદન અપનાવવા માટે સ્થિરતા ઉમેરતા ફેરફારોનો સંગ્રહ છે.
OpenZFS 2.3.4 કેવી રીતે ડાઉનલોડ કરવું, પરીક્ષણ કરવું અથવા અપગ્રેડ કરવું
જો તમે મુદ્દા પર પહોંચવા માંગતા હો, તો OpenZFS 2.3.4 ડાઉનલોડ્સ ની સાથે GitHub પર ઉપલબ્ધ છે આ પ્રકાશનની નોંધો, અને ઘણા વિતરણો તેમના સ્થિર ભંડારોમાં પેકેજો પ્રદાન કરશે. જેઓ પસંદ કરે છે તેઓ કરી શકે છે સ્ત્રોતોમાંથી સંકલન કરો અને ઉત્પાદનમાં જમાવટ કરતા પહેલા સ્ટેજીંગ વાતાવરણમાં માન્ય કરો.
જેઓ નજીકના ભવિષ્યનું પરીક્ષણ કરવા માંગે છે, ટીમ તમને પ્રયાસ કરવા માટે પ્રોત્સાહિત કરે છે ઓપનઝેડએફએસ 2.4.0 આરસી1 અને પ્રતિસાદ સબમિટ કરો. પ્રોજેક્ટ પોતે સંદર્ભ શાખા સામે RC ફેરફારોની યાદી બનાવવા માટે આદેશ પ્રદાન કરે છે: git cherry -v zfs-2.3-release master | sed '/^-/d; s/+ //g'. કયા પેચો એકીકૃત કરવામાં આવ્યા છે તે જોવાની આ એક ઝડપી રીત છે.